The authorities compare the security videos in which the exact moment in which a hitman entered the exclusive Galileo restaurant in Cúcuta (Norte de Santander) and murdered the well-known rector of the Comfanorte school was recorded.

EL TIEMPO revealed for the first time that the victim is Jorge Enrique Galvis Carillo, who was with his romantic partner.
Padlock plan and ‘fake news’

The Police immediately deployed a padlock plan and Local authorities announced that they are offering up to 30 million pesos as a reward for anyone who helps in the capture of the masterminds and perpetrators of the homicide, which occurred in the Caobos neighborhood.

”There are already clues to the identity of the hitman and the escape route he used.“a judicial source told EL TIEMPO.
And he added that the information circulating on networks according to which the hitman appeared dead on the outskirts of Cúcuta is false. In fact, a photo is circulating on behalf of a local media in which a subject of similar build is seen lying on the floor with several impacts to the head.

The possible motives
According to those close to the victim, she had no threats against her and in addition to academic activities, she was part of the team at the Family Subsidy Superintendence, in charge of the intervention of the Norte de Santander compensation fund.

“A contract for almost 9 billion is being investigated for the expansion of the facilities, to which the rector was opposed,” a prestigious journalist from Cúcuta assured EL TIEMPO. And he said that the intervention of the fund was suspended.

Galvis Carrillo was a graduate in Biology and Chemistry, Specialist in Educational Computing Administration and Specialist in Educational Management.
